Management Meeting Minutes — Reseller Programme

Present: Dena Forsgate, Ollie Rennick, Priya Calloway.

Quick recap: the Fernlight reseller programme is tracking ahead of plan — 14 partners signed versus the 10 we'd hoped for. Margins are a bit thinner than modelled, mostly down to the tiered discount we offered early joiners. Ollie will tighten the discount bands before the next intake. Where we want to take the programme next is covered in the note below.

board note of yahip-tadug: Headcount on the Zorath team goes from 9 to 100 by the end of April. Gross margin on Zorath came in at 10 percent against a plan of 20 percent.

Handover note — Crumbwheel order cutoffs.

Welcome aboard. The bakery cutoff rule in Crumbwheel closes same-day orders at 14:00 local to each storefront, not UTC — this has bitten us twice. Holiday overrides live in the calendar service and take precedence silently, so always check there first when a cutoff looks wrong. To unlock the calendar service's admin console after a restart, enter the recovery passphrase below.

vault phrase of bagap-bahaf = silion-pelox-sorox-casdor-quenwyn-fraax-eliox-praael-kelion-quenvan-kasox-rusael-norius-belvan

Management Meeting Minutes — Hedging Decision

Attendees agreed to hedge 65% of forecast solari-denominated receivables for the next two quarters via forwards arranged through Branwick Capital. Motion proposed by T. Oruna, seconded by F. Kells, carried unanimously. Sales leads should quote export deals at the locked rates circulated by Treasury. The strategic context for this decision is recorded below.

confidential, kagep-kahof: Druokax Systems plans to lower the Ulaath list price by 53 percent in March.